Question

  • a neuron at rest is known as its ………………………. this is when a neuron stable electrical charge difference between the inside and the outside of the cell, which is resting potent.
  • a neuron receives incoming signals at its dendrites. if the stimulation is strong enough to reach the ………………………, the neuron will fire.
  • when the neuron is stimulated strongly enough, an action potenti is triggered,. this causes sodium ions to rush in and flip the charge to positive in a process is called ……………………….
  • after the signal passes, the neuron works to restore its negative charge by pushing positive ions back out, a process called ………………………. during this resetting time, the neuron is in a brief ………………………, meaning it cannot fire again until it has fully recovered.

Explanation:

Brief Explanations
  1. First blank (neuron at rest term): The stable electrical charge difference of a neuron at rest is its resting potential (the given "resting potent" is likely a typo, correct term is resting potential).
  2. Second blank (threshold for firing): A neuron fires when stimulation reaches the threshold (the minimum level of stimulation needed to trigger an action potential).
  3. Third blank (process of sodium influx): The process where sodium ions rush in and flip the charge positive is depolarization (this is the phase of action potential where the membrane potential becomes less negative, then positive).
  4. Fourth blank (restoring negative charge): Pushing positive ions out to restore negative charge is repolarization (follows depolarization, restores the negative resting potential).
  5. Fifth blank (refractory period): The brief time when a neuron can’t fire again is the refractory period (absolute or relative, during which it recovers).
